"Wild Fire Rebels" is a genuinely extreme single-barrel release from Rare Character's ongoing revival of Brook Hill — a Kentucky whiskey name with real historical weight, originally crafted by Joseph L. Friedman, a figure from the late 19th-century pioneer Kentucky whiskey movement whose Brook Hill brand achieved the genuinely rare distinction of maintaining legal production straight through Prohibition. This particular cask, Barrel No. C653, carries a full 10 years of maturation and is drawn exclusively from that single barrel — bottled uncut and unfiltered, with nothing removed and nothing added, at a genuinely staggering 149.72 proof (74.86% ABV).

That number puts Barrel C653 firmly within what collectors informally call "hazmat" proof territory — strong enough that it can't legally be flown on a commercial aircraft — and it's exactly the kind of extreme, one-of-one release serious American whiskey collectors specifically seek out. Origins & Craftsmanship

Brook Hill is a whiskey brand with roots in the late 19th-century pioneer era of Kentucky whiskey, originally crafted by Joseph L. Friedman, whose Brook Hill brand maintained legal production through Prohibition — a genuine point of historical distinction. Rare Character Whiskey Co., an independent bottler known for meticulous single-barrel selections, has since revived the Brook Hill name, releasing individual barrels of both bourbon and rye under its own careful curation.

"Wild Fire Rebels" is drawn exclusively from Barrel No. C653, a straight rye whiskey aged a full 10 years, bottled uncut and unfiltered at its full, natural barrel strength — 74.86% ABV / 149.72 proof. The extended decade of maturation has developed substantial mature-oak depth and concentration well beyond what younger rye typically achieves, part of Rare Character's broader, highly limited Brook Hill collection of individually selected bourbon and rye barrels.
